Fme Flow Architecture Mouse over to view architecture diagram: a web application server runs the fme flow web user interface, fme flow web services, and any other web clients. depending on the installation, the web application server may be a version of apache tomcat included with fme flow, or provided separately. Fme flow is built on a fault tolerant architecture, compatible with different engines. in critical scenarios, rely on recovery mode to restore fme flow configurations and components.
Choosing A Deployment Architecture In summary, choosing the right fme flow deployment architecture depends on your organization's performance, scalability, and reliability needs. express deployments are ideal for simplicity and cost efficiency, while distributed deployments offer greater flexibility and scalability. Comprised of redundant fme flow core and web application server components spread across additional host machines, this architecture ensures that if a hardware component fails, fme flow remains online. This diagram demonstrates the recommended 2 tier architecture, with the web application server, fme flow core, and fme engines running on the same host, and separate servers for the fme flow database and fme flow system share.
